- Supreme Sikh Society distributed 1,160 food parcels in South Auckland on Saturday.
- Previous drive on April 18 gave over 1,000 parcels in under three hours.
- Food parcels included milk, bread, and vegetables.
- Volunteers spent a week preparing the packages.
- Event aimed to support families facing hardship, especially children.
